Capillary Viscometers
Capillary viscometers are a basic and broadly used technique for measuring viscosity. These devices depend on the precept of fluid circulate by a slender capillary tube. The time taken for a selected quantity of fluid to circulate by the tube is instantly associated to its viscosity. This easy strategy gives a comparatively fast and cheap technique for preliminary estimations of viscosity.
These devices are sometimes used for routine high quality management checks.The vary of viscosity measurements sometimes dealt with by capillary viscometers is usually restricted to particular fluids, with narrower ranges in comparison with different strategies. Accuracy and precision can fluctuate relying on the design and high quality of the instrument, however they’re typically appropriate for much less demanding purposes. The simplicity of operation makes them well-liked for instructional settings.
Rotational Viscometers
Rotational viscometers, a extra versatile possibility, make the most of a rotating spindle immersed within the pattern fluid. The torque required to rotate the spindle is instantly proportional to the viscosity of the fluid. This technique is good for measuring a broader vary of viscosities and fluid sorts, together with these with advanced rheological properties. Subtle fashions supply extremely correct and exact measurements.The vary of viscosity measurements these devices can deal with is sort of broad, accommodating every little thing from skinny liquids to extremely viscous supplies.
This versatility makes them appropriate for all kinds of business and analysis purposes. Fashionable rotational viscometers supply superior options like automated knowledge acquisition and complicated evaluation instruments, guaranteeing reliability. They typically present increased accuracy and precision than capillary viscometers, making them a most popular alternative for high quality management in manufacturing.
Falling-Ball Viscometers
Falling-ball viscometers make use of a identified sphere that’s dropped right into a liquid. The time it takes for the sphere to fall a selected distance gives an oblique measure of the fluid’s viscosity. The method leverages the interaction between gravity, the sphere’s weight, and the resistance of the fluid. This technique is comparatively easy and sometimes utilized in instructional settings or for preliminary viscosity estimations.These devices normally cater to a extra restricted vary of viscosity values.
Accuracy and precision are influenced by elements just like the sphere’s measurement and the fluid’s density. Regardless of the potential for slight inaccuracies, the strategy stays a helpful instrument for preliminary assessments or introductory experiments.

Automotive Functions
Understanding the viscosity of motor oil is paramount for engine efficiency. Completely different working temperatures and circumstances necessitate various viscosity ranges. A high-viscosity oil can defend parts beneath excessive load however can hinder chilly begins. Conversely, a low-viscosity oil permits for simpler chilly begins however may not present adequate safety at excessive temperatures and hundreds. Viscosity take a look at kits enable technicians to make sure the proper oil is used for the particular circumstances, resulting in optimized engine life and gasoline effectivity.
Engine producers typically specify particular viscosity grades for his or her autos, and viscosity take a look at kits be certain that drivers adhere to those specs.
